Release: For hearing aids with AGC, the time between an
abrupt change from 90 to 55 dB input SPL and the time
when the coupler SPL has stabilized to within 4 dB of the
steady value for a 55 dB input SPL, at one or more of 250,
500, 1000, 2000, 4000 Hz, with the gain control at RTS.
SPLITS Response
For hearing aids with an inductive input coil (T-coil), the
coupler SPL as a function of frequency when the hearing
instrument, with gain control at RTS, is oriented for maxi-
mum output on a telephone magnetic field simulator
(TMFS).
IEC60118-7
These IEC60118-7 measurements are supported:
OSPL90 curve
OSPL90 Curve measures coupler output sound pressure
level (OSPL) as a function of frequency, for a 90 dB input
SPL.
HFA OSPL90
HFA OSPL90 displays the high frequency average (aver-
age SPL at 1 kHz, 1.6 kHz and 2.5 kHz) for a 90 dB input
SPL.
Full-On Gain
Full-On Gain (FOG) displays gain for an input of
50 dBSPL when the gain of the hearing instrument is at its
full-on position.
HFA Gain
HFA Gain displays the HFA FOG for an input of
50 dBSPL when the gain of the hearing instrument is at its
full-on position.
Set RTS
An interactive dialog to set the Reference Test Setting,
using the volume control on the DUT.
Frequency Response
Coupler SPL as a function of frequency for a 60 dB input
SPL, with gain control at RTS.
Battery Current
Electrical current drawn from the battery when the input
SPL is 65 dB at 1000 Hz and the gain control is at RTS.
Equivalent Input Noise
SPL of an external noise source at the input that would
result in the same coupler SPL as that caused by all the
internal noise sources in the hearing instruement.
Harmonic Distortion
Ratio of sum of the powers of all the harmonics to the
power of the fundamental at various levels and frequencies.
Input Output
For hearing aids with AGC, the coupler SPL as a function
of the input SPL, at one or more of 250, 500, 1000, 2000,
4000 Hz, with the gain control at RTS.
Attack and Release
Attack: For hearing aids with AGC, the time between an
abrupt change from 55 to 90 dB input SPL and the time
when the coupler SPL has stabilized to within 3 dB of the
steady value for a 90-dB input SPL, at one or more of 250,
500, 1000, 2000, 4000 Hz, with the gain control at RTS.
Release: For hearing aids with AGC, the time between an
abrupt change from 90 to 55 dB input SPL and the time
when the coupler SPL has stabilized to within 4 dB of the
steady value for a 55 dB input SPL, at one or more of 250,
500, 1000, 2000, 4000 Hz, with the gain control at RTS.
